找回密码
 加入
搜索
查看: 2236|回复: 1

[AU3基础] 【已解决】如何在Excel中根据数据自动生成柱状图?

[复制链接]
发表于 2017-4-10 10:12:54 | 显示全部楼层 |阅读模式
本帖最后由 xowen 于 2017-4-10 15:18 编辑

想达到的效果如下图所示,将A2-4作为分类系列,B2-F2作为X坐标,B2-F4这个区间的作为柱状图的数据,这个怎么写?当前试了一下这个代码,但是无效:

将A2-4作为分类系列,B2-F2作为X坐标,B2-F4这个区间的作为柱状图的数据
$PIC=$CExcelBook.Activesheet.chartobjects.add(0,200,200,150)
$PIC.chart.charttype=51
$Chart=$PIC.chart.SeriesCollection.NewSeries()
$Chart.Values = "Sheet1!$A$2:$F$4"
哪位大神指导一下,谢谢了!"Sheet1!$A$2:$F$4"是手动制作柱状图时显示的区域。

当前生成单个图表没问题,例如,生成User1 A2,B2-F2的单独柱状图是OK 的,生成代码:
$PIC=$CExcelBook.Activesheet.chartobjects.add(0,200,200,150)
$PIC.chart.charttype=51
$Chart=$PIC.chart.SeriesCollection.NewSeries()
$Chart.Name = "=Sheet1!$A2"
$Chart.Values = "=Sheet1!$B$2:$F$2"

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?加入

×
发表于 2017-4-12 08:59:27 | 显示全部楼层
回复 1# xowen
如何生成,能赐教吗?
您需要登录后才可以回帖 登录 | 加入

本版积分规则

QQ|手机版|小黑屋|AUTOIT CN ( 鲁ICP备19019924号-1 )谷歌 百度

GMT+8, 2024-12-22 11:18 , Processed in 0.086279 second(s), 24 queries .

Powered by Discuz! X3.5 Licensed

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表